Brazilian forward Kerolin Nicoli is the latest guest in the hotseat on the Official Man City Podcast…
As always, the chat is informal and relaxed as we delve into the lives of our players, past and present.
The Brazil international joined City in January and in discussion with George Kelsey and Nedum Onuoha, she talks about her spell in America followed periods in Brazil and Spain as she established herself as one of world football’s most exciting talents.
“When I started [playing football], I started playing in the streets,” she said.
“This was more painful and hard; I think every time when I was playing I just was hurting my toes and it’s just part of the game.
“I can’t describe how it helps but it, for sure, brings out something strong in me. I have so much love to play now on the good pitches and at City, it’s a dream.”
Kerolin also talks of her pride in representing Brazil, adding: “When you play for your national team it’s always a dream. I just feel really happy and it’s an honour,” Kerolin Nicoli declared.
“When I’m there I want to try my best for my whole country, family and friends. I just feel really excited, and I really believe people are saying at my age now I’m starting to reach my best moment.”
